titleOfInvention METHOD IN VIVO CANCER VISUALIZATION
abstract 1. A method for identifying and / or monitoring a cancer in a subject where said cancer is characterized by abnormal expression of peripheral benzodiazepine receptors (PBR), comprising the steps of: (a) administering to said subject an in vivo imaging agent of the formula I: wherein: R is C1-6alkyl or C-fluoroalkyl; R is hydrogen, hydroxy, halogen, cyano, Ci-Ci, Calkoxy, C-fluoro-ci or C-fluoroalkoxy; R and R are independently Ci-Ci, Saralkyl, or R and R together with the nitrogen atom to which they belong They are united to form a nitrogen-containing Salifaticheskoe ring optionally containing 1 additional heteroatom selected from nitrogen, oxygen and sulfur; Ypredstavlyaet is O, S, SO, SOili CH; and Y is CH, CH-CH, CH (CH) -CH or CH-CH-CH; and wherein said in vivo imaging agent of formula I contains an atom that is a radioisotope suitable for in vivo imaging; (b) allowing the binding of said in vivo imaging agent from step (a) with PBR expressed in said subject; (c) detecting signals emitted by a radioisotope contained in said in vivo associated imaging agent from step (b) using a suitable in vivo imaging method; (d) image generation expression reflecting the distribution and / or the number of these signals detected in stage (c); (e) determining the distribution and / or degree of PBR expression in the specified subject, where the specified expression directly correlates with the distribution and / or the number of these signals presented in the specified the image obtained in stage (g); and (e) use
